Abstract

The utility model relates to an-pry anti-theft electronic lock control device which comprises a telescopic bolt arranged in each lock body, a driving motor driving the bolts to extend to realize the unlocking as well as an extension detector arranged on each lock body, wherein, each extension detector comprises an electric current detection module connected with the driving motor in series and a door-opening detection module connected with the bolt; a central monitor is arranged; when a cabinet door is opened, the door-opening detection module connected with the bolt in the lock body outputs the signal to a central detector, the motor in the lock body can not work if the cabinet door is illegally opened or prized, thereby failing to trigger the electric current detection module to work; now the central detector can simply judge if the cabinet is illegally opened by that the door-opening detection module outputs the signal to the central detector, thereby making an alarm prompt. With the control device, the real-time monitoring to the locking cabinets of sauna bathrooms can be realized.

Description

A kind of pick-proof and anti-theft electronic lock control device
Technical field
The utility model relates to a kind of pick-proof and anti-theft electronic lock control device, particularly is useful in the electronic lock control of sauna bathroom.
Background technology
The locker of existing sauna bathroom is opened the cabinet door by checking card, the lock body of this electronic lock generally includes the circuit control section and is subjected to the mechanical component of circuit control section control, this mechanical component generally is made up of the member of dead bolt and the turnover of drive dead bolt, the circuit control section is generally by driving the flexible motor of dead bolt, for the battery of motor power supply is formed, the pre-set code of unblanking when each cabinet is locked in production, promptly have only the card of setting same code just can open this cabinet lock, this kind card is called legal card, when opening the cabinet lock with legal card, the circuit control section carries out work in the lock body, circuit can produce a current drives machine operation greater than 100mA is opened the cabinet door, and for illegal card, thereby this electronic lock can not produce electric current cabinet Men Buhui and be opened, though this kind cabinet lock is difficult for being opened with other card, but it is easy to be pried open, because locker is more in sauna chamber, waiter can not the time be engraved in sauna chamber and make an inspection tour, therefore this just needs a kind of electronic lock control device, it can be monitored all cabinet locks that are arranged on sauna chamber under the situation of not destroying existing lock body, be opened as the cabinet door and can judge that the cabinet door is opened and illegally open or legal opening, can carry out alarm if illegally open.

The specific embodiment
Below in conjunction with accompanying drawing, describe particular content of the present utility model in detail for example:
Accompanying drawing 1 is the electric theory diagram of the utility model pick-proof and anti-theft electronic lock control device, it comprises a plurality of lock bodies 1 that are installed in sauna chamber, be installed in an exchange monitor 3 of information desk, wherein each lock body 1 comprises a drive motors 2, be subjected to drive motors 2 controls and the dead bolt 5 of action, described drive motors 2 is arranged in the battery case of power supply, dead bolt 5 is arranged on the cabinet door, in battery case, be electrically connected with current detection module 41 with drive motors, the detection module 42 that opens the door is connected with dead bolt 5 on the cabinet door, wherein, current detection module 41 comprises the relay 411 that is in series with drive motors 2, the emission control module 412 that is electrically connected with relay 411 outputs, pass through drive motors 2 as big electric current, feasible relay 411 adhesives that are in series with drive motors, trigger 412 work of emission control module after relay 411 adhesives, emission control module 412 is launched the information encoding of this lock body; The detection module 42 that opens the door comprises the tongue tube 421 that is connected with described dead bolt 5, the control module 422 of opening the door that is electrically connected with tongue tube 421 outputs, when the cabinet door is opened, thereby the tongue tube 421 closed control modules 422 of opening the door that trigger are worked, the control module of opening the door 422 can be launched the information encoding of this lock body equally, and the described current detection module 41 and the detection module 42 that opens the door constitute the extension set detector 4 that is arranged on each lock body 1.
Exchange monitor 3 comprises the receiving circuit module 31 that is electrically connected successively, the exchange microprocessor control module 32 that is electrically connected with described receiving circuit module 31, alarm indication module 33, the receiving circuit 31 of exchange monitor 3 receives transmitting of the emission control module 412 and the control module 422 of opening the door respectively, and signal outputed to exchange microprocessor control module 32, this module compares signal and handles the back as find then output alarm information of received signal unanimity, then exports control information and triggers described alarm indication module 33 and report to the police if find that received signal is inconsistent.
Accompanying drawing 2 is the circuit theory diagrams of current detection module 41, comprise relay 411, the emission control module 412 that is electrically connected with the output of relay 411, wherein, the input IN of relay 411 and the positive pole of drive motors 2 are electrically connected, emission control module 412 comprises microprocessor U2, the peripheral circuit that is electrically connected with microprocessor U2, comprise the memory circuit that constitutes by U3, by two-stage triode N2, the radiating circuit that N1 forms, microprocessor U2 has a plurality of inputs and a plurality of output, wherein an input is by C3, C4, the oscillation circuit that X2 forms provides frequency of oscillation for processor U2, mu balanced circuit U4 provides the standard operation voltage vcc for microprocessor and memory circuit U3, by R10, the reset circuit that C7 constitutes, the input of microprocessor U2 also comprises three operating key K1, K2, K3, these three operating keys are used to set the numbering of each lock body, and the output of microprocessor U2 is sent signal by antenna at last via triode N1 and N2.

The physical circuit operating principle is as follows:
When with the legal row that sticks into when unblanking, the drive motors 2 of lock body 1 begins to rotate and have the described drive motors 2 of big electric current process of 100mA, the relay adhesive that is in series with drive motors 2, the microprocessor U2 work that is triggered, the numbering of this lock body that microprocessor U2 will configure sends through antenna that (this numbering is predefined, during the dress lock, pass through to press K1 by the engineering staff, K2, the number of times of K3 is set, assurance does not have repetition with numbering in a collection of lock), when lock body has big electric current to pass through, drive motors 2 will drive dead bolt and unblank, the cabinet door of locker will be opened, when the cabinet door is opened, tongue tube 421 is just closed, the numbering of this lock body that control module 422 will configure thereby triggering is opened the door sends through antenna, simultaneously, after sending the coding of lock body, send an identical confirmation code of launching again with the emission control module, be arranged on exchange monitor 3 received signals of information desk, at first receive the signal that current detection module 41 sends, what then receive is the signal that detection module 42 sends that opens the door, when the signal that sends from current detection module 41 identical with the signal of detection module 42 transmissions of opening the door, at this moment, the exchange monitor thinks that this unblanks is legal opening, not display alarm information.
When the cabinet door of locker is not normally to open by legal card, but the cabinet door is pried open, at this moment exchange monitor 3 only can be received the transmission signal of the detection module 42 that opens the door, and current detection module 41 can not exported correct signal to exchange monitor 3, the exchange monitor 3 will think that the cabinet door of this locker is pried open this moment, thereby thereby driving numbering that alarm indication circuit 33 shows the lock body of being pried open informs that waiter should lock and pried open.
